Tanner Foust joins Cobb Tuning for Foust Edition Ford Focus ST
Wed, 13 Mar 2013Professional wheelman Tanner Foust is teaming up with Cobb Tuning to create the Tanner Foust Edition Ford Focus ST. The car will go on sale later this year. Loosely based on the concept unveiled at the SEMA show in November, the car will be upgraded with a custom ECU calibration -- by Cobb, of course -- and an intercooler, intake, exhaust and suspension components.
Seat confirms new SUV model: is Skoda next?
Wed, 26 Mar 2014By Ollie Kew and Damion Smy Motor Industry 26 March 2014 13:00 Seat has officially announced today that it is developing an all-new compact SUV model to join the Spanish outfit’s range in 2016. Seat says that the new SUV is already two years into development at the company’s Martorell technical facility in Spain. The as yet unnamed car is likely to share engines and platform with other ‘compact SUVs’ made by parent company, Volkswagen Group, such as the next-gen VW Tiguan and Audi Q3, which will use the MQB modular architecture.
